Alexander Bastrykin puts under supervision investigation of a probe into rendering of services that do not meet standards of safety for life of health of rural school pupils in the Republic of Dagestan

On April 29, 2021 a federal channel broadcast a story of pupils of Khutrakh general school of Tsunta district of the Republic of Dagestan studying in almost substandard building and risking to be trapped under the rubble every day they enter their classrooms. The Dagestan Republican Investigative Department launched a probe into this fact under Part 1 of Article 238 of the Criminal Code of Russia (rendering of services that do not meet safety standards).

Under investigation of the probe investigators will seize and examine relevant documents referring to this situation. Provided the grounds, actions (inaction) of authorities will be given legal assessment.

Chairman of the Investigative Committee of Russia Alexander Bastrykin instructed to report on investigation progress and planned investigative actions and put the probe under supervision of the Central Office of the Investigative Committee.
